Schools

Kindergarten through fifth graders can find many options. P.S. 290 Manhattan New School, PS 77 Lower Lab School, P.S. 267 East Side Elementary School, P.S. 6 Lillie D. Blake School, P.S. 183 Robert L. Stevenson School, and P.S. 158 Bayard Taylor School all offer a solid start for young learners. Schools like Ella Baker School and Yorkville Community School serve pre-k to fifth grade, enriching students with a strong foundation. Middle school students have choices such as J.H.S. 167 Robert F. Wagner School, East Side Middle School, and Yorkville East Middle School, spanning grades six to eight. Above it all, high school options include Eleanor Roosevelt High School and Talent Unlimited High School, culminating in academic achievement.

The Neighbourhood: Upper East Side

Upper East Side is a historic, upscale area on Manhattan's east side. The area has famous museums like the Metropolitan Museum of Art, and it borders Central Park with riverside paths and small parks. The district offers groceries, pharmacies, cafes, medical centers, and local shops that sell food, clothes, and home goods. Some good schools and a few hospitals stand in the area. Subways, buses, and bike lanes give quick access to Midtown and other parts of the city. Ferries and direct road routes add more travel options for short trips.

Frequently Asked Questions about Upper East Side

What is it like to live in Upper East Side, New York, NY?

The Upper East Side is known for its quiet, tree-lined streets and upscale living. Residents enjoy proximity to Central Park, fine dining, and cultural institutions like museums. The area offers a mix of historic buildings and modern luxury apartments, making it appealing for affluent city dwellers.

Is Upper East Side, New York, NY expensive?

The Upper East Side is known for its high real estate prices. Many apartments and brownstones are listed at premium rates. This area is popular among affluent buyers due to its amenities and location.

What is the weather of Upper East Side, New York, NY?

The Upper East Side experiences cold winters with possible snowfall. Summers are warm and can be humid, with temperatures often rising. Spring and fall provide mild and pleasant weather, making them popular times to be outdoors.

How safe is Upper East Side, New York, NY?

The Upper East Side is generally considered a safe neighborhood. It has low crime rates compared to other areas in New York City. Residents often report feeling secure due to active street life and regular police presence.
